1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2024-11-30 13:29:56 +00:00

Cleaning up batch file locations

This commit is contained in:
Jeremy Ruston 2012-05-05 23:32:04 +01:00
parent a99f34fcae
commit cce472789d
4 changed files with 32 additions and 17 deletions

2
.gitignore vendored
View File

@ -1,3 +1,3 @@
.DS_Store .DS_Store
tmp/ tmp/
rabbithole/tmp/ archive/tmp/

14
bld.sh
View File

@ -7,7 +7,15 @@ mkdir -p tmp
mkdir -p tmp/tw5 mkdir -p tmp/tw5
# cook TiddlyWiki5 # cook TiddlyWiki5
node ../core/boot.js --verbose \
pushd tw5.com > /dev/null
node ../core/boot.js \
--verbose \
--savetiddler ReadMe ../readme.md text/html \ --savetiddler ReadMe ../readme.md text/html \
--savetiddler $:/core/tiddlywiki5.template.html tmp/tw5/index.html text/plain \ --savetiddler $:/core/tiddlywiki5.template.html ../tmp/tw5/index.html text/plain \
--savetiddler $:/core/static.template.html tmp/tw5/static.html text/plain || exit 1 --savetiddler $:/core/static.template.html ../tmp/tw5/static.html text/plain \
|| exit 1
popd > /dev/null

29
run.sh
View File

@ -2,16 +2,23 @@
# run TiddlyWiki5 # run TiddlyWiki5
node ../core/boot.js --verbose --wikitest ../tests/wikitests/ || exit 1 pushd tw5.com > /dev/null
node ../core/boot.js \
--verbose \
--wikitest ../tests/wikitests/ \
|| exit 1
popd > /dev/null
# run jshint # run jshint
jshint ../core/*.js jshint ./core/*.js
jshint ../core/modules/*.js jshint ./core/modules/*.js
jshint ../core/modules/commands/*.js jshint ./core/modules/commands/*.js
jshint ../core/modules/macros/*.js jshint ./core/modules/macros/*.js
jshint ../core/modules/macros/edit/*.js jshint ./core/modules/macros/edit/*.js
jshint ../core/modules/macros/edit/editors/*.js jshint ./core/modules/macros/edit/editors/*.js
jshint ../core/modules/parsers/*.js jshint ./core/modules/parsers/*.js
jshint ../core/modules/parsers/wikitextparser/*.js jshint ./core/modules/parsers/wikitextparser/*.js
jshint ../core/modules/parsers/wikitextparser/rules/*.js jshint ./core/modules/parsers/wikitextparser/rules/*.js
jshint ../core/modules/treenodes/*.js jshint ./core/modules/treenodes/*.js

View File

@ -7,7 +7,7 @@
# default values # default values
REMOTE_USER=${1:-$USER} REMOTE_USER=${1:-$USER}
FROMDIR=$PWD/../tmp/tw5 FROMDIR=$PWD/tmp/tw5
HOST="tiddlywiki.com" HOST="tiddlywiki.com"
DIR="/var/www/www.tiddlywiki.com/htdocs/tiddlywiki5" DIR="/var/www/www.tiddlywiki.com/htdocs/tiddlywiki5"
OWNER="www-data:www-data" OWNER="www-data:www-data"
@ -23,7 +23,7 @@ function setPermissions() {
echo "uploading files" echo "uploading files"
FILES="$FROMDIR/index.html $FROMDIR/index.xml" FILES="$FROMDIR/index.html $FROMDIR/static.html"
scp $FILES "$REMOTE_USER@$HOST:$DIR" scp $FILES "$REMOTE_USER@$HOST:$DIR"
echo "setting file permissions" echo "setting file permissions"